We are looking for Associates to join our market-leading Employment Practice. Our Employment team works with our clients on the full range of domestic and international employment issues. We collaborate with a broad range of blue-chip and global clients across sectors including financial services, TMT, healthcare, transport, consumer products, publishing, and retail. This is an exciting opportunity to join an expanding and leading London team working on high-quality, varied, and interesting work, including global projects and transactions, high-profile domestic advisory work, complex litigation and investigations, and strategic HR advisory work. We welcome applications from candidates with excellent academics and broad employment experience from a top-tier Employment practice.

The Team

Our London team comprises over 45 dedicated employment lawyers. We work closely with our Employee Benefits lawyers and Pensions Department. Our practice involves working with HR and in-house legal teams on daily employment queries. Our lawyers have recognized technical expertise in areas such as discrimination, collective rights, workplace change (including TUPE, mergers and acquisitions, restructurings, outsourcing, collective consultation, trade union issues, and EWCs), employment tribunal litigation, appellate courts, High Court litigation, investigations, and data privacy.

We are known for providing commercial, cost-effective, decisive, and pragmatic advice. Our first-tier ranking in legal directories reflects our commitment to delivering the best results for our clients. We invest in developing our team, maintaining expertise, and working closely with clients. Our broad client base allows us to offer diverse perspectives and well-rounded advice across sectors. Our practice is ranked Band 1 in both Chambers UK and Legal 500, and we are part of the only Band 1 ranked employment practice in Chambers Global worldwide.

Possible matters include:

Transactions

  • Leading UK M&A transactions, including due diligence, drafting and negotiating employment provisions, and advising on TUPE and related consequences.
  • Advising on global or multi-jurisdictional carve-out transactions, working with local teams on employment-related implementation, relocations, changing terms, restructuring, and employee relations.
  • Advising on UK and global outsourcing, TUPE application, mitigation, and drafting operational clauses and indemnifications.
  • Advising on redundancies, procedural requirements, pooling, selection, and consultations in individual and collective contexts.
  • Handling day-to-day client queries: disciplinary procedures, grievances, sickness, performance, whistleblowing, contracts, policies, and data protection. Also advising on terminations and settlement agreements.

Multi-jurisdictional Projects

  • Leading on global or regional HR projects and transactions.

Litigation

  • Managing Employment Tribunal claims, including form preparation, witness statements, merits, and settlement considerations.
  • Providing advice on restrictive covenants and High Court litigation.

Baker McKenzie is a global law firm with 13,200 people across 74 offices in 45 countries. Founded in 1949, we advise many of the world's most successful organizations. Our culture promotes collaboration, support, and high standards. In London, our largest office, we offer the experience of a leading firm in a friendly, supportive environment.
